SHOW FILTER (50)

Showing 50 products

Pyramid Seeds - Amnesia Gold
Free Seeds
New
£6.99
Pyramid Seeds - Alpujarrena
Free Seeds
New
£6.99

This website uses cookies to improve service. By using this site, you agree to this use.